Sorrow Fist is a character that appears in Mario & Luigi: Dream Team, as one of Big Massif's four Hooraw disciples that must be fought in the Beef-off. He is a thin Hooraw with blue hair and pants, a sad face and an inferiority complex.
In battle, Sorrow Fist surrounds himself with Hooraws. In order to defeat him, Mario must use Excellent hits -- anything short of that will heal him the amount of damage Mario would've dealt otherwise. In one attack, a seashell will drop from the sky, which Sorrow Fist will hit, sending it flying at Mario -- the plumber must use his Hammer to send it back at him. Sorrow Fist will also charge at Mario, flailing his arms -- Mario can counter-attack by jumping on him.

Trivia
- When Sorrow Fist is hit, he appears to look like Edvard Munch's The Scream painting.
